Asansol Engineering College was established in the year 1998 in West Bengal. It is a highly sought-after institution and an affiliated college recognised by AICTE, offering the various branches of the undergraduate engineering courses along with management programmes sprawling across 17 acres of campus with an enrolment of 2,655 students and 160 faculty members, teaching 14 courses under 5 degree programmes. The undergraduate programme has nearly equal rations of sexes, comprising 70 percent males and 30 percent females. It offers specialisations in the most modern technological areas like artificial intelligence, machine learning, and the Internet of Things. The AEC has state-of-the-art laboratories well equipped for hands-on training, a library with great numbers of reference books and e-journals, and modern IT infrastructures for digital learning.
AEC offers two independent hostels, boys and girls, where students can enjoy well-facilitated residential facilities, which are comfortable and convenient. There is a cafeteria, sports facilities, and a gymnasium on campus to ensure a good work-life balance in routine. An auditorium has been used as an event and seminar venue that enriches a vibrant culture in campus life. The health centre contains first-aid facilities. The college has a guest house where visiting faculty members along with their family members can be accommodated. AEC provides a broad range of courses to accommodate diversified academic interests. The institute offers 11 undergraduate programs, wherein the popular B.Tech courses are in Computer Science and Engineering, Information Technology, Electronics, and Communication Engineering.
Apart from these, it also offers postgraduate programmes like M.Tech in Electrical Engineering and Electronics and Communication Engineering with an MCA programme. The college also runs BBA and BCA courses meant for those interested in management and computer applications. Total intake of AEC in all its programmes is 2,655. The most coveted one is B.Tech in Computer Science and Engineering, with an intake of only 240 students.
The merit-cum-entrance-based admission process is followed at Asansol Engineering College. WBJEE and JEE Main are conducted for admission into B.Tech programmes. To get eligible to pursue any of these programmes at Asansol Engineering College, a candidate has to seek competitive ranks in these examinations. The West Bengal University of Technology conducts PGET examinations, and admission is done based on rank to get into postgraduate engineering courses. For the MCA course, admission is through the JECA examination conducted by the West Bengal Joint Entrance Examination Board.
